    We have stayed here twice and LOVED it. OK, it's the European type of B and B. You share the kitchen with the other folks. But, before you get all cranky about that, we rarely saw the other folks in the kitchen and when we did, it was fun because they were from Denmark and we learned much. Otherwise, we thought we were the only people staying there. No noise at all. Our room was fabulous. We had a king size bed, a beautiful shower and bathroom area, and a table and chairs outside on the patio. We loved watching the bats come for dinner. Don't be alarmed, the bats are small and eat bugs. They don't come near you. This place is very close to one of the entrances to Yosemite. Unless you are staying in the park itself, you really can't find a more convenient place. Eddie, the owner, is a font of knowledge and will steer you clear to the right places. Love Evergreen Haus and wish I could live there.

As far as our stay went, let me start out by saying that Judy, the owner, is a total sweetie. She greeted us with open arms and a big smile. She showed us to our room (room 1), which had a "private" porch, "private" hot tub, and a beautiful view. Then, she sat us down and explained to us the rules, which were plenty: Take a shower before using the hot tub , hair up in the hot tub, only use the green towels for the hot tub, don't waste electricity, keep the noise to a minimum, don't drink too much in the hot tub, don't waste water, "quite time" starts at 9pm, etc....she said if any of the rules were broken, we would be charged extra. For $170 a night, we didn't expect as many rules. This was my boyfriend's first visit to Yosemite so I wanted to stay someplace wonderful. Although Vulture's View was nice and had an amazing view from the hot tub, it was not as wonderful as I had expected for the price. The first night we enjoyed a beer and a delicious dinner at Yosemite Forks Mountain House Restaurant in Oakhurst. Yum! I would definitely recommend this restaurant. The next morning we got up at 4:30am and headed to Yosemite to hike Half Dome. Great time. We returned after dinner, around 8:30pm, a little surprised to find that our bed was not made and our towels were not replenished. Also, we were not given any additional food for the next day's breakfast. Pros: * Friendly hosts * Deer frequently roam the property * the private outdoor jacuzzi w/ amazing view * comfortable bed w/ nice sheets * nice fireplace (although it was way too hot to use it) * the room was stocked with fruit, mini-cereal, coffee, a mini fridge, a microwave, etc. * flat-screen tv w/ cable & dvd player * room was a cool temperature (providing a nice relief from the heat outside) . Cons: * We had a non smoking room, but it smelled of cigarette smoke. * Jacuzzi wasn't that hot (and took a LONG time to heat up) * the grounds could have been kept up a little bit better * too many rules * we left for the day and when we came back our bed was not made and towels were not replenished. * dirty wine glasses :( * although there was a coffee maker in the room, the coffee and cream were not good. (and I was really looking forward to a cup of coffee after waking up at 3:30am before hiking Half Dome) * the alarm clock's alarm was broken Recommendations: * Bring a bottle of wine to enjoy while watching the sunset in the hot tub * Bring your own shampoo, conditioner, and body wash. * Make sure to read the guest book (filled with many cute stories) * Bring your own coffee and cream (and some food to stock your mini-fridge)
